Deploying Cisco Application Virtual Switch For ACI (2/2)
AVS is the Virtual Switch For ACI Fabric. Application Virtual Switches are the purpose-built, hypervisor-resident virtual network edge switches designed for the ACI fabric. They provide consistent virtual networking across multiple hypervisors to simplify network operations and provide consistency with the physical infrastructure.
